[QUOTE="Manzanita, post: 4401587, member: 10109"] Ogrin retreats to hide behind the marble statue of 'the Thinker'. The statue is on a base, and larger than life. Pushing it over is probably beyond Ogrin's strength, but it does not seem to be anchored to the ground. He hears the sound of a key tinkling in the lock. Whoever is using the key seems to have to work a bit to get it to work. At last he hears a click, and the door creaks open. He hears a deep voice speaking. Another deep voice answers. He can't understand what they are saying. The door is pulled shut, and the key is inserted into the lock again. Again, it takes a bit of fiddling to lock the door. Once the door is locked, two sets of heavy footfalls start down the corridor. Does Ogrin peek out to see who they are, either while they are entering, or while they pass? -------- Banion sees the knight coming, and sets himself to defend. The knight's great black sword whistles through the air. The blade [URL="http://invisiblecastle.com/roller/view/1678923/"]misses[/URL]. The knight now stands directly in front of Banion. The corridor is 15 feet wide, and 30 feet down is a door (currently closed- but Banion knows it will open if he touches the panel next to it. There is a slight delay, about 3 seconds, between touching the panel and the door opening.) [/QUOTE]
